Extreme rainfall in African countries has killed roughly 2,000 people and displaced millions more in recent months .

A recent study by the World Weather Attribution found that extreme rainfall recorded in Sudan , Cameroon , Niger , Nigeria , and Chad is causing extreme climatic vulnerability due to climate change.

The continued severity of these floods is predicted to cause massive destruction within the countries.
